Skip to content
Browse files

Added License and README files

  • Loading branch information...
1 parent 22a96e3 commit dde8fd2cedde4e549127d17cab8908d178c55029 @davglass committed Apr 13, 2012
Showing with 66 additions and 0 deletions.
  1. +30 −0 LICENSE
  2. +36 −0 README.md
View
30 LICENSE
@@ -0,0 +1,30 @@
+Software License Agreement (BSD License)
+
+Copyright (c) 2012, Dav Glass <davglass@gmail.com>.
+All rights reserved.
+
+Redistribution and use of this software in source and binary forms, with or without modification, are
+permitted provided that the following conditions are met:
+
+* Redistributions of source code must retain the above
+ copyright notice, this list of conditions and the
+ following disclaimer.
+
+* Redistributions in binary form must reproduce the above
+ copyright notice, this list of conditions and the
+ following disclaimer in the documentation and/or other
+ materials provided with the distribution.
+
+* The name of Dav Glass may not be used to endorse or promote products
+ derived from this software without specific prior
+ written permission of Dav Glass.
+
+TH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ND ANY EXPRESS OR IMPLIED
+W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A
+P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R CONTRIBUTORS BE LIABLE FOR
+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T
+L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S
+IN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R
+T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F
+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
+
View
36 README.md
@@ -0,0 +1,36 @@
+YUITest Wrapper for PhantomJS
+=============================
+
+A little command line tool for running [http://yuilibrary..com/yuitest](YUITest) html
+files inside of PhantomJS.
+
+This release supports exiting with the proper exit code to fail a build.
+
+Installation
+------------
+
+You must have the `phantomjs` command line tool installed prior to running this.
+
+ npm -g install grover
+
+Output
+------
+
+ grover app/tests/app.html yui/tests/index.html loader/tests/index.html editor/tests/editor.html
+ Starting Grover on 4 files with PhantomJS@1.5.0
+ :) [App Framework] Passed: 246 Failed: 0 Total: 246 (ignored 0)
+ :) [YUI Core Test Suite] Passed: 41 Failed: 0 Total: 42 (ignored 1)
+ :) [Loader Automated Tests] Passed: 52 Failed: 0 Total: 52 (ignored 0)
+ :( [Editor] Passed: 30 Failed: 1 Total: 31 (ignored 0)
+ Failed! test: EditorSelection
+ Unexpected error: 'null' is not an object
+ ---------------------------------------
+ :( [Total] Passed: 369 Failed: 1 Total: 371 (ignored 1)
+
+
+
+What's with the name?
+---------------------
+
+This tool is dedicated to [https://github.com/rgrove](Ryan Grove) for all his work on YUI over the last year.
+I told him that my next command line tool would be named "grover" after "rgrove".

0 comments on commit dde8fd2

Please sign in to comment.
Something went wrong with that request. Please try again.